Top Recommendations for Paper 1 (General Aptitude)
Paper 1 is common to all candidates and evaluates teaching skills, research capabilities, and logical reasoning. Scoring high in this segment is vital to making the final JRF merit list.
Teaching & Research Aptitude by K.V.S. Madaan: Widely considered an essential manual for this exam. It breaks down complex topics like Data Interpretation and Higher Education Systems into simple, scannable explanations.
UGC NET Paper 1 by Pearson Publications: Excellent for targeted practice questions and mathematical reasoning shortcuts.
Oxford NTA UGC NET Paper 1 by Harpreet Kaur: Known for clear conceptual clarity and high-quality mock questions that align with recent digital exam trends.
Essential Selection Criteria for Choosing Reference Material
With hundreds of guides available in the market, it is easy to accumulate unnecessary books. When searching for the Best Books for UGC NET Preparation, look for these key indicators:
📄 Inclusion of Previous Years’ Question Papers (PYQs)
A good textbook should not just provide theory; it must include solved question banks from recent years. Practicing real questions ensures you understand the exact depth a topic demands.
🎯 Alignment with the Revised NTA Syllabus
The exam format occasionally shifts focus toward specific practical application areas. Ensure your chosen edition is updated and covers core subjects comprehensively.
⏳ Explanatory Solutions and Shortcut Methods
For the logical, quantitative, and data interpretation sections, choose books that show step-by-step methods and alternative quick techniques to optimize your time management.
📊 Streamlining Your Preparation Strategy with Standard Textbooks
Buying the Best Books for UGC NET Preparation is only half the task; utilizing them efficiently is what guarantees success. Follow this structured roadmap to optimize your textbook studies:
Read the Syllabus First: Never study a book from cover to cover. Cross-reference your syllabus line by line and mark the specific chapters you need.
Make Concise Notes: Convert dense textbook paragraphs into scannable bullet points and concept maps for efficient final revision.
Solve Unit-Wise Quizzes: As soon as you finish a chapter from your standard book, test your retention immediately by solving related question pools.
